Polish food is delicious, varied, and a real melting pot of influences. If you’re visiting Krakow, a food tour is a fantastic way to learn about the city’s gastronomic heritage while sampling some of its best dishes.
During the 3.5-hour tour, you’ll sample 13-14 Polish foods at some of the best spots in Krakow. Experience Old Town Market Square as well as wander through the Jewish District Kazimierz. After sampling Polish street food we sit down to enjoy a food platter and then we will try traditional Polish main courses.
Your English-speaking guide will share stories and anecdotes about Krakow’s rich food culture.
